An aircon capacitor is a crucial component in air conditioning units that helps manage the electrical energy required for the compressor and fan motors to operate efficiently.

Introduction

Air conditioning systems rely on various components to function properly, and one of the most important is the aircon capacitor. This small yet vital part plays a significant role in starting and running the compressor and fan motors. When the air conditioning unit is powered on, the aircon capacitor stores electrical energy and releases it when needed, ensuring smooth operation. A faulty capacitor can lead to inefficient cooling, increased energy consumption, and even system failure.

Here are some key points about aircon capacitors:
  • Types: There are different types of capacitors, including start capacitors and run capacitors, each serving a specific purpose in the air conditioning system.
  • Signs of Failure: Common indicators of a failing aircon capacitor include unusual noises, the air conditioning unit not starting, or it shutting off unexpectedly.
  • Replacement: If you suspect your aircon capacitor is faulty, it is essential to replace it promptly to avoid further damage to your system.
  • Choosing the Right Capacitor: Ensure you select a capacitor that matches the specifications of your air conditioning unit for optimal performance.
  • Professional Help: If you're unsure about diagnosing or replacing an aircon capacitor, it's advisable to seek assistance from a qualified technician.
Regular maintenance and timely replacement of aircon capacitors can help prolong the life of your air conditioning system and maintain its efficiency. By understanding the importance of this component, you can ensure your home stays cool and comfortable during hot weather.

FAQs

How can I choose the best aircon capacitor for my needs?

To choose the best aircon capacitor, refer to the specifications of your air conditioning unit, including voltage and capacitance ratings, and ensure compatibility with your system.

What are the key features to look for when selecting aircon capacitors?

Key features include the capacitor's voltage rating, capacitance value, type (start or run), and the manufacturer's reputation for quality and reliability.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ing aircon capacitors?

Common mistakes include buying a capacitor with incorrect specifications, neglecting to check compatibility with the existing system, and overlooking the importance of quality brands.

How do I know if my aircon capacitor is failing?

Signs of a failing aircon capacitor include the air conditioning unit not turning on, unusual noises, or intermittent operation. If you notice these symptoms, it may be time to replace the capacitor.

Can I replace an aircon capacitor myself?

While it is possible to replace an aircon capacitor yourself, it is recommended to consult a professional if you are not experienced with electrical components to ensure safety and proper installation.
